Health Food Scanning App By TM03

A food scanner app is a convenient tool that helps users make informed choices about what they eat. These apps are designed to scan food products using your smartphone’s camera and provide nutritional information, ingredients, and even potential allergens in a matter of seconds. They use databases of food items to deliver accurate results, making it easier for people to track their calorie intake and ensure they follow a balanced diet. With rising health concerns and dietary restrictions, food scanner apps have become a must-have for individuals who want to maintain a healthier lifestyle.

One of the primary benefits of using a food scanner app is its ability to offer instant nutritional insights. Instead of manually reading the tiny print on food labels, users can simply scan the product barcode to get a detailed breakdown of nutrients such as calories, proteins, fats, and carbohydrates. This feature is especially useful for fitness enthusiasts and those managing health conditions like diabetes or high blood pressure. By providing real-time data, these apps enable users to monitor their daily intake and stay on track with their health goals.

In addition to nutritional information, food scanner apps often come with features that identify harmful additives and allergens. For people with food sensitivities or allergies, these apps can be lifesavers. They can alert users about ingredients like gluten, lactose, or artificial preservatives that might not be immediately visible on the label. This helps people avoid unwanted health risks and maintain a diet that aligns with their specific needs. The ability to filter food options based on allergies makes food scanner apps a reliable companion for safe and healthy eating.

Another key advantage of food scanner apps is their role in promoting mindful eating habits. Many apps come equipped with tracking tools that allow users to log their meals and review their eating patterns over time. By reflecting on their food choices, users can make better decisions and adopt healthier behaviors. Some apps even offer personalized recommendations to enhance dietary habits, such as suggesting nutrient-rich alternatives. This proactive approach helps users stay informed and make conscious decisions that benefit their overall well-being.
